Morning Prayer for Family
Introduction
Family shapes our days in countless ways—through shared meals, quick goodbyes, laughter, and sometimes a few sharp words before the coffee cools. In the middle of all that motion, it’s easy to forget that family itself is a gift of God’s grace.
This Morning Prayer for Family invites us to begin the day by asking God not only to protect our loved ones but to knit our hearts together in kindness. Whether family lives under our roof or across the miles, we can entrust each one to the care of the One who never loses sight of them.
Scripture for the Morning
“Above all, clothe yourselves with love, which binds everything together in perfect harmony.” — Colossians 3:14 (NRSV)
Reflection
Every family has its rhythms—the morning rush, the evening quiet, the small conversations that shape a lifetime. Yet love doesn’t always come easily. Sometimes it must be chosen again and again, even when we’re tired or misunderstood.
Colossians reminds us that love is what binds it all together. It’s the thread that weaves through chores and car rides, meals and prayers. When we clothe ourselves in love each morning, we bring Christ into our homes—not through grand gestures, but through gentleness, forgiveness, and patience.
This prayer is a way of saying: “God, help us live today as family in your love.” It’s a simple start, but one that can change the tone of an entire day.
Prayers for the Day
A Prayer for Family Unity
Lord, thank you for the gift of family—each person with their own joys, quirks, and ways of showing love. {pause}
Thank you for laughter that fills our home and for lessons learned even in tension. {pause}
Bless our home with peace when we’re hurried, patience when we’re tired, and understanding when we see things differently. {pause}
Teach us to speak kindly, forgive quickly, and love deeply, as you have loved us. {pause}
Let our home be a small reflection of your kingdom—where grace and truth meet, and love always has the last word. Amen. {pause}
A Prayer for Children and Parents
God, be with our children today—wherever they go, whatever they face. {pause}
Give them confidence that they are loved and courage to stand for what is right. {pause}
For parents and guardians, give wisdom that listens before it speaks, and strength that doesn’t fade when the day is long. {pause}
Fill our home with laughter that heals and words that build up. {pause}
May we learn from one another how to live as your family—rooted in grace and growing in love. Amen. {pause}
A Prayer for Families Near and Far
Lord, watch over those we love who live apart from us. {pause}
Keep them safe in your care and close in our hearts. {pause}
When distance makes us ache, remind us that prayer bridges every mile. {pause}
Bless family gatherings and quiet phone calls alike; let each moment of connection remind us that we belong to you. {pause}
Thank you for the gift of belonging—to each other and to you. Amen. {pause}
Kid’s Morning Prayer for Family
Dear God, thank you for my family! {pause}
Help us be kind and love each other today. {pause}
Keep everyone safe and happy. Amen. {pause}
